What is a Detailed Ventilation Training Course?
An extensive ventilation training course includes different facets of respiratory system care, concentrating on both academic expertise and practical skills necessary for reliable ventilatory monitoring. These programs commonly cover topics such as:
- Understanding ventilator settings Airway management techniques Tracheostomy care Patient evaluation in respiratory distress Hands-on experience with different types of ventilators
Participants normally consist of registered nurses, breathing therapists, and other doctor associated with essential care settings.

1. Boosted Knowledge and Skills
Understanding the Basics
One of the main benefits of registering in a thorough ventilation training course is acquiring foundational understanding regarding air flow principles. For instance, participants get understandings into what ventilator assistance entails, how ventilators work, and the various settings available-- such as assist-control and stress support.
Practical Application
Theoretical knowledge needs to be coupled with hands-on experience to be absolutely reliable. Programs commonly include simulations where trainees method making use of different sorts of ventilators on mannequins or even genuine people under guidance. This twin approach ensures that individuals not only recognize principles yet can apply them effectively.
